C语言实现的密码输入功能
来源:互联网 发布:字体识别在线软件 编辑:程序博客网 时间:2024/06/09 15:35
#include<stdio.h> #include<stdlib.h> #include<conio.h> #include<ctype.h> int main() { int n,p; char ch,acnt[256],pwd[256]; scanf("%d",&n); while(n--) { system("cls");//清屏 p=0; puts("请输入账号:"); scanf("%s%*c",acnt); puts("请输入密码:"); while((ch=getch())!='\r')//判断是否是回车 { if(ch==8)//实现backspace键的功能,其中backspace键的ascii码是8 { putchar('\b'); putchar(' '); putchar('\b'); if(p>0)//最多只能删到没有字符 p--; } if(!isdigit(ch)&&!isalpha(ch))//判断是否是数字或字符 continue; putchar('*');//在屏幕上打印星号 pwd[p++]=ch;//保存密码 } pwd[p]=0;//结束字符串 printf("\n账号:\n%s\n密码:\n%s\n",acnt,pwd); p=0; system("pause"); } return 0; }
0 0
- C语言实现的密码输入功能
- C语言实现的密码输入功能
- C语言实现密码输入功能
- C语言实现输入密码
- C语言实现密码输入
- C语言控制台下实现模拟密码的输入
- C语言实现输入的密码与设置密码进行比对,输入密码可以任意输入。
- C语言实现 输入密码显示星号******
- C语言实现密码输入显示星号 VS2010 亲测通过 功能加强版
- 具有密码输入隐藏功能(c语言编)
- c语言,功能简单的电话簿,实现输入,显示,查找的功能
- C语言编程中实现输入密码回显星号
- C语言编程中实现输入密码回显星号
- Linux下C语言实现 密码不回显输入
- [心得]C语言中实现密码输入 回显星号*
- C语言编程中实现输入密码回显星号
- 用C语言实现输入密码是显示为***
- Linux 环境下C语言下实现密码输入无回显
- Map阶段分析之Spill阶段
- 欢迎使用CSDN-markdown编辑器
- hdu1789 简单贪心算法
- 关键字【一】
- c++数据结构二叉树
- C语言实现的密码输入功能
- 服务迁移总结
- U-boot主Makefile详尽分析
- [心得] Thrift协议以及相关压测经验踩坑总结
- HDFS中高可用性HA的讲解
- 嵌入式学习心得(十)变量和常量以及内存
- hadoop笔记1-MR执行过程
- html课程表页面
- 软件工程项目问题记录(一)